Simultaneous diffusion of isotopes from a radioactive series in homogeneous and isotropic solids

The simultaneous diffusion of the members of a radioactive series is analyzed. The diffusion equations consider both the radioactive production and decay of each of the series members, including the effect of radioactive recoil for alpha decays. Hydrodynamic coupling between the several isotope fluxes is not considered. The diffusion equations are solved in spherical coordinates for general initial and Dirichlet boundary conditions. The obtained solutions are applied in an example of the influence of diffusion and alpha recoil on the disequilibrium between the five initial isotopes of the uranium series
